During this phase, the current business process will be reviewed. The faculty hiring process will be
streamlined, including automating faculty recruiting using workflow and electronic approvals. This effort
will eliminate paper processes and add online tools to facilitate the hiring process within and across
schools and central administration. This effort will also result in one repository for staff applicants and
faculty candidates for EEO and other reporting agencies. Since FASIS (HRIS) will be upgraded to
Version 9.1 in the beginning of calendar year 2010, developing this process will be on hold in order to
understand and take advantage of the new recruiting features in the upgrade. After the faculty
enhancements are done in FASIS (HRIS), then the requirements gathering for the recruiting process for
faculty, post docs, and staff will begin.
At the completion of Phase 1 and 2, we will have one University-recognized source for all faculty data.
The initiatives will utilize FASIS (HRIS) to build out faculty academic pages and centralize information
from the faculty reporting database, thus creating a Faculty and Staff Information System(FASIS) and a
FASIS (HRIS) data mart to support enhanced information management and reporting utilizing current
technology, security measures and resources.
